Tesla's $25 Billion Bet: The Strategic Pivot to AI and Robotics

Tesla has announced a staggering $25 billion capital expenditure budget for 2026, tripling its prev…
The Strategic Pivot to AI and Robotics Elon Musk kicked off the first-quarter earnings call with a stark warning and a bold promise: Tesla is no longer just an automaker; it is evolving into a full-scale AI and robotics powerhouse. To achieve this, the company has announced a staggering $25 billion capital expenditure budget for 2026, a threefold increase from its previous annual spending. This figure, which covers physical assets outside of day-to-day operations, is designed to accelerate the company's transition beyond electric vehicles (EVs) and solar energy. AI Infrastructure: A significant portion of the funds will be funneled into AI training, chip design, and data centers to support the company's autonomous driving ambitions. Optimus Production: Tesla plans to scale up production of its Optimus humanoid robot at the Fremont facility and has cleared ground for a dedicated manufacturing plant in Austin. Advanced Manufacturing: The company is investing in a new semiconductor research fab in Austin and strengthening its supply chain across batteries, energy, and AI silicon. The Economics of the $25 Billion Bet Tesla's capital expenditures have ballooned from $8.5 billion in 2025 to $11.3 billion in 2024, and now to a projected $25 billion in 2026. While the company reported $44.7 billion in cash reserves at the end of Q1, CFO Vaibhav Taneja warned that Tesla will likely enter negative free cash flow territory later this year. Despite a brief 4% share price bump due to a $1.4 billion free cash flow surprise, investors erased gains in after-hours trading, signaling concern over the burn rate. Competitive Landscape: The AI Arms Race Tesla is not operating in a vacuum; it is aligning its spending strategy with tech giants to stay competitive. The company is effectively merging the automotive and tech sectors, betting that the next era of revenue will come from software and robotics rather than hardware sales alone. Amazon is projecting $200 billion in capital expenditures in 2026, focusing on AI, chips, and robotics. Google is slated to spend between $175 billion and $185 billion in capital expenditures in 2026, up from $91.4 billion the previous year. Future Outlook: Navigating the Innovation Gap The next few years will be critical for Tesla's valuation. The company is trading current cash reserves for future revenue streams, betting that its Optimus robots and AI software will generate returns that justify the current capital burn. Investors will be watching closely to see if the $25 billion investment translates into tangible revenue streams by 2027, or if it creates a prolonged period of financial drag that competitors can exploit.

Apple Patches Critical iOS 18 Vulnerability Exposing Deleted Messages

Apple released a critical update for iOS 18 to address a security flaw where deleted messages remai…
The Critical Privacy Flaw in iOS 18 Apple has released a software update for iPhones and iPads running iOS 18 to address a significant security vulnerability that exposed deleted private communications to law enforcement. The bug allowed forensic tools to extract message content that had been marked for deletion or automatically removed by messaging apps, due to a flaw in how the operating system handled notification caches. How Law Enforcement Exploited the Notification Cache The vulnerability was first brought to light by 404 Media, which reported that the FBI successfully used forensic tools to extract deleted Signal messages from a suspect's device. The issue stemmed from the fact that the content of messages was displayed in system notifications and subsequently stored in the device's database, even after the user deleted the messages within the app. Notification Retention: Notifications marked for deletion were unexpectedly retained on the device for up to a month. Signal's Response: Meredith Whittaker, president of Signal, called for the fix, stating that "notifications for deleted messages shouldn't remain in any OS notification database." Backporting: Apple backported the security patch to older versions of iOS 18 to ensure a broad range of devices were protected. The Future of OS-Level Privacy Protections This incident highlights a growing tension between operating system design and end-to-end encryption promises. For users relying on self-destructing features—such as the timer in Signal or WhatsApp—to protect sensitive conversations from authorities, this bug represented a critical failure point. As privacy activists express alarm over the ease with which law enforcement bypassed these security measures, the industry can expect increased pressure on OS developers to ensure that notification handling does not compromise user privacy.

Google Cloud Unveils Next-Gen AI Chips to Challenge Nvidia

Google Cloud has announced its eighth generation of custom-built AI chips, including the TPU 8t for…
Google Cloud's Next-Gen AI Chip Strategy Google Cloud has unveiled its eighth generation of custom-built AI chips, or tensor processing units (TPUs), which will be split into two distinct chips: the TPU 8t for model training and the TPU 8i for inference. The Performance Boost The new TPUs promise significant performance upgrades, including up to 3x faster AI model training, 80% better performance per dollar, and the ability to cluster over 1 million TPUs together. This should result in more compute power at a lower energy consumption and cost for customers. Supplementing, Not Replacing Nvidia While Google's new chips are a strategic move, they are not a direct challenge to Nvidia's future. Instead, Google will continue to offer Nvidia-based systems in its infrastructure, with plans to make Nvidia's latest chip, Vera Rubin, available later this year. The company is also collaborating with Nvidia on software-based networking tech called Falcon. The Future of AI Chip Development The hyperscalers, including Amazon, Microsoft, and Google, are investing heavily in their own AI chips. While this may reduce their reliance on Nvidia in the long term, the current market dynamics suggest that Nvidia will continue to thrive. Google's growth as an AI cloud provider could, in fact, lead to more business for Nvidia. Collaboration and Innovation Google and Nvidia are working together to engineer computer networking that allows Nvidia-based systems to perform more efficiently in Google's cloud. This partnership highlights the complex and collaborative nature of the AI chip ecosystem.

Google Pixel 10a Review: Incremental Upgrade at an Attractive Price Point

The Google Pixel 10a offers solid performance and excellent camera quality at a competitive price p…
The Evolution of Google's Budget FlagshipThe Google Pixel 10a represents the company's latest attempt to bring flagship-level features to a more affordable price point. Priced from £449 (€549/$499/A$849), this device aims to deliver the core Pixel experience without the premium cost of the main Pixel 10 line. While it maintains many of the strengths that make Google phones appealing, it also highlights Google's strategy of creating a tiered product lineup where the "A" series serves as a more accessible entry point.Minimal Hardware Advancements, Maximum ValueDespite being marketed as a new model, the Pixel 10a shares significant hardware similarities with its predecessor, the Pixel 9a. Both devices feature the same Tensor G4 processor, identical memory configurations, camera systems, and 6.3in OLED displays. The primary hardware improvement is the increased peak brightness on the 10a's screen, making it slightly more readable in outdoor conditions. Google has maintained the flat design language with aluminum sides, glass front, and a high-quality plastic back, continuing the trend of eliminating the camera bump that has plagued smartphones for years.Competitive Pricing in a Crowded MarketAt £449 starting, the Pixel 10a positions itself in the mid-range segment where it faces competition from devices like the Samsung Galaxy A series and various Chinese manufacturers. The pricing strategy demonstrates Google's understanding of the market—offering premium features at a more accessible price point. The device includes several premium features typically reserved for more expensive models, such as emergency satellite messaging and long-term software support until March 2033. This approach allows Google to compete on value rather than raw specifications, a strategy that has proven successful in the past.Software Experience as the Key DifferentiatorWhere the Pixel 10a truly distinguishes itself is in the software experience. The device runs a clean version of Android with Google's signature optimizations and prompt updates. The inclusion of the Gemini AI assistant provides access to Google's latest AI capabilities, though notably absent are some of the more advanced on-device AI features found in the premium Pixel 10 line, such as Magic Cue and the Pixel Screenshots app. The camera system remains a standout feature, with the 48MP main and 13MP ultrawide cameras delivering exceptional image quality that rivals more expensive flagships. New additions like auto best take for group photos and camera coach enhance the photography experience without adding complexity.The Future of Google's A-Series StrategyThe Pixel 10a suggests Google will continue its strategy of creating a clear distinction between its premium A-series and flagship models. While the A-series receives incremental upgrades and slightly older components, it benefits from the same long-term software support and core AI capabilities as the more expensive models. This approach allows Google to maintain brand prestige while expanding its market reach. Looking ahead, we can expect Google to further integrate its AI capabilities across all price points, potentially making the A-series the primary vehicle for democratizing advanced AI features. The success of this strategy will likely depend on Google's ability to balance hardware differentiation with software consistency across its product lineup.

Sony AI's Ace Robot: A New Benchmark in Human-Machine Table Tennis

Sony AI's robotic system, Ace, defeated elite table tennis players in a competitive series, showcas…
The LeadSony AI's robotic system, Ace, has achieved a historic milestone by defeating elite table tennis players in a competitive series, marking a significant leap in robotic perception and motor control.Ace vs. The Elite: A Breakthrough in Competitive RoboticsThe Sony AI system, named Ace, competed under official competition rules against professional athletes, securing three victories out of five matches. While it lost to two professional players, the robot demonstrated a mastery of spin and the ability to handle difficult shots, such as balls catching on the net.Hardware Innovation: Ace utilizes an eight-jointed arm on a movable base, avoiding the complexities of bipedal locomotion.Visual Perception: The system relies on multiple cameras to track the ball's position and spin in milliseconds, rather than human-like eyes.Key Maneuver: Ace successfully executed a rapid backspin shot that a professional player had previously deemed impossible.Training at Scale: The Numbers Behind the VictoryThe robot's performance is the result of extensive computational training and engineering. The system was honed through 3,000 hours of games played in computer simulations, supplemented by expert player data for serves.Spin Analysis: By zooming in on the ball's logo, Ace can estimate spin and axis of rotation with high precision.Adaptability: While Ace excels at complex spins, it struggles with simple "knuckle serves" (low spin), which allows human players to gain an advantage.Why Table Tennis is the Ultimate Stress Test for AITable tennis is widely considered one of the toughest challenges for robotics due to the lightning-fast reactions and perception required. Unlike games like chess, which are decision-based, table tennis requires the machine to enact decisions effectively in the physical world.Experts note that Ace presents a unique psychological challenge; it has no eyes to read and no body language to gauge, making it an unpredictable and relentless opponent.The Next Decade of Robotics: Beyond the TableWhile the achievement is impressive, experts like Jan Peters of the Technical University of Darmstadt argue that table tennis research does not solve broader manipulation challenges. However, Peters predicts a transformative moment in the next decade for robotics, suggesting we may be closer to a breakthrough comparable to the impact of ChatGPT in 2022 than to 2036.

Google Cloud Next: AI Overviews Arrive in Gmail for the Workplace

At Google Cloud Next, Google announced the expansion of its AI Overviews feature from consumer sear…
Google Cloud Next: The Enterprise AI Shift During its recent Google Cloud Next conference, Google signaled a major pivot in its enterprise strategy by extending its AI Overviews feature from consumer search tools to the workplace. This move marks a critical step in integrating generative AI directly into daily business workflows, moving beyond simple search assistance to comprehensive inbox management. Transforming Inbox Management with AI Overviews The core of this update is the ability for Gmail users to interact with their inbox using natural language. Instead of manually sifting through threads to find specific information, employees can now ask questions like "What are the project milestones?" or "What are the comments on the deck?" The AI will then synthesize answers from across multiple emails and conversations, providing a concise summary without requiring the user to open individual messages. Expanding the AI Ecosystem Beyond Search This rollout represents a significant expansion of Google's AI capabilities. Previously exclusive to consumers with AI Pro and Ultra subscriptions, AI Overviews is now being made broadly available to business, enterprise, and education customers. The feature is integrated into the existing "Gemini for Workspace" and "Workspace Intelligence" frameworks, requiring users to have specific smart features enabled to access the new capabilities. Redefining the Inbox as an Intelligent Workspace The integration of AI Overviews into Gmail reflects a broader industry trend where AI is rapidly becoming the default interface for information retrieval. By automating the summarization of routine business communications—such as invoices, performance updates, and trip details—Google is reducing the cognitive load on employees. This shift suggests that the traditional "inbox" is evolving from a storage repository into an intelligent query engine. The Future of Email: From Storage to Synthesis As AI tools become more sophisticated, the traditional model of reading every email is likely to give way to a model of intelligent curation. Google's move to make AI Overviews a default setting for Workspace Intelligence sets a precedent for how enterprise software will handle information overload in the coming years, prioritizing synthesis and retrieval over exhaustive reading.

The Anatomy of Mythos: Anthropic's Strategic Halt on a Cybersecurity Weapon

Anthropic's refusal to release its latest frontier model, Mythos, due to its ability to exploit zer…
The LeadAnthropic has made the unprecedented decision to withhold its latest frontier model, Mythos, from the public domain, citing an existential threat to global cybersecurity infrastructure. This move comes after a report of unauthorized access and highlights the terrifying potential of AI to automate the discovery and exploitation of critical system flaws.The Anatomy of Mythos: A Zero-Day WeaponMythos is not merely a chatbot; it is a specialized AI model designed to identify and exploit zero-day vulnerabilities—flaws in software that are unknown to developers and have no patch available. Anthropic announced the model on 7 April but immediately ruled out public release, describing it as a "watershed moment for cybersecurity." The model can theoretically identify unnoticed flaws in every major IT operating system and web browser, some of which have persisted for decades.Project Glasswing: Anthropic has restricted access to select partners, including Apple and Goldman Sachs, to assess risks.Unauthorized Access: A "handful" of users in a private online forum reportedly gained access to the model, raising alarms about containment.Quantifying the Threat: The AISI AssessmentThe UK's AI Security Institute (AISI) has conducted a rigorous assessment, confirming that Mythos represents a significant step up in cyber-threat capabilities. The institute noted that Mythos can carry out multi-step attacks without human guidance, a capability previously unattained.Attack Simulation: Mythos successfully completed a 32-step simulation of a cyber-attack, a first for the AISI.Vulnerability Discovery: The model flagged thousands of zero-day flaws across complex systems, including FreeBSD.Expert Nuance: While some analysts argue the hype is overstated compared to cheaper models, the ability to chain attacks is a distinct evolution.Financial Sector on High Alert: Project Glasswing and Regulatory ResponseThe potential for Mythos to fall into the wrong hands has triggered a systemic response from the global financial sector. With 40 companies involved in Project Glasswing, the stakes extend far beyond technology firms.Regulatory Action: The US Treasury Secretary and UK regulators have convened emergency meetings to discuss the risks.Systemic Risk: UK government modelling suggests a successful hack could disrupt direct debits, mortgages, and cash withdrawals, potentially causing a bank run.Defense vs. Offense: Banks are rushing to integrate Mythos into their defenses, but the dual-use nature of the technology remains a primary concern.The Containment Paradox: Can We Keep Dangerous AI in the Box?The unauthorized access to Mythos proves that even closed-source, high-security models are vulnerable to insider threats. The future of AI safety now hinges on the "containment paradox": the difficult task of leveraging these powerful tools for defense while preventing them from becoming autonomous weapons.As AI capabilities accelerate, the window for safe, controlled deployment is closing. The industry must move beyond simple testing to establish robust governance frameworks before these models become ubiquitous.
